Why Dredging is Essential for Waterfront Properties

Sediment accumulation is a natural process caused by currents, tides, storms, and runoff. While it’s a part of nature, it can cause serious problems for boaters, property owners, and marine businesses. Shallow waters not only limit access for larger vessels but can also increase the risk of propeller damage, groundings, and accidents. Dredging addresses these issues by removing excess sediment and restoring the required depth for safe navigation. In addition to improving functionality, dredging can also protect marine infrastructure, extend the lifespan of docks and piers, and support environmental balance in the surrounding waterways.

Handling Dewatering and Disposal

Dredging doesn’t end when sediment is removed from the water. Proper disposal is a crucial step to ensure compliance with environmental regulations and avoid contamination risks.
